TEXT 40
- aho he putrakā yūyam
- asmad-arthe 'ti-duḥkhitāḥ
- ātmā vai prāṇinām preṣṭhas
- tam anādṛtya mat-parāḥ
SYNONYMS
aho—ah; he putrakaḥ—O children; yūyam—you; asmat—our; arthe—for the sake; ati—extremely; duḥkhitāḥ—have suffered; ātmā—the body; vai—indeed; prāṇinām—for all living beings; preṣṭhaḥ—the most dear; tam—that; anādṛtya—disregarding; mat—to me; parāḥ—dedicated.
Translation and purport composed by disciples of Śrīla Prabhupāda
TRANSLATION
[Sāndīpani said:] O my children, you have suffered so much for my sake! The body is most dear to every living creature, but you are so dedicated to me that you completely disregarded your own comfort.
